To Drain or Not to Drain?

Many pond owners fall into a cycle of draining and refilling their pond every time the water turns green. While this provides temporary relief, it destroys the beneficial bacteria colonies that keep water naturally clear. Each drain-and-refill resets the biological clock to zero, and the same problems return within weeks.

The better approach is continuous mechanical and biological filtration. A properly designed system works around the clock:

  • Bottom drain/intake pulls debris from the pond floor before it decomposes
  • External serviceable filter traps particles and provides a home for beneficial bacteria
  • UV treatment eliminates single-cell algae that cause green water
  • Biological media converts toxic ammonia and nitrites into harmless compounds

When these four components are sized correctly for your pond's volume and maintained on schedule, the result is consistent, predictable water clarity. No draining required. No seasonal "green phase." Just clear water, all season long.

The Three Pillars of Clear Water

Right Sizing

Every filtration component is calculated from your pond's actual volume and bioload -- not estimated, not approximated. An undersized filter is worse than no filter because it creates a false sense of security.

Proper Installation

Professional plumbing, correct pipe diameters, proper electrical, and accessible filter housings. Every component is installed for maximum performance and easy servicing.

Consistent Maintenance

The best filtration system in the world fails without regular cleaning, media replacement, and water quality monitoring. Maintenance membership ensures none of this gets missed.

Filtration without maintenance degrades. Filters clog, UV bulbs lose effectiveness, biological media becomes saturated. Within a few months, even the best system underperforms. By pairing filtration with scheduled professional care, we ensure every component operates at capacity all season.

Clear water means you can see the bottom of the pond and observe fish at any depth. Specifically, it means no green water (suspended algae), no persistent turbidity (cloudy water), and no surface film. Some string algae on rocks is normal and healthy in an ecosystem pond -- that is not a clarity issue. Our guarantee addresses the water column itself.
